Which country hosted the first FIFA World Cup?
Correct Answer :
Uruguay
Solution :
The correct answer is Uruguay.
Step-by-step Explanation:
1. The inaugural FIFA World Cup was held in the year 1930.
2. FIFA selected Uruguay as the host nation to celebrate the centenary of Uruguay's first constitution and because the national football team had successfully retained their football title at the 1928 Summer Olympics.
3. All matches were played in the Uruguayan capital, Montevideo, primarily at the Estadio Centenario.
4. Uruguay also went on to win the tournament, defeating Argentina in the final.
